- Description of Pictures: Jackie Craven, Lisa Dordal, Dan Brady -- Lisa Dordal and Jackie Craven write from different perspectives about what it means to be human, and the complicated emotions and expectations everyone faces.
Jackie Craven
Latest Title: Secret Formulas & Techniques of the Masters
Born into a family of artists, Jackie Craven turns colors into words. Her new poetry collection, “Secret Formulas & Techniques of the Masters” (Brick Road), transforms Northern Virginia into a fanciful world where paintings speak. Her chapbook, “Our Lives Became Unmanageable” (Omnidawn), won the publisher’s award for fabulist fiction. Jackie’s work has appeared in dozens of journals, including The Asheville Poetry Review, New Ohio Review and the Massachusetts Review. Now based in New York State, she’s also the author of books on interior design and more than 500 articles on art and architecture.
Lisa Dordal
Latest Title: Mosaic of the Dark
Lisa Dordal holds a Master of Divinity and a Master of Fine Arts in poetry, both from Vanderbilt University, and teaches in the English Department at Vanderbilt. She is a Pushcart Prize-nominated poet, and the recipient of an Academy of American Poets University Prize, the Robert Watson Poetry Prize and the Betty Gabehart Poetry Prize. Her work has appeared in Best New Poets, Ninth Letter, CALYX, The Greensboro Review, Vinyl Poetry and “Nasty Women Poets: An Unapologetic Anthology of Subversive Verse.” Her first full-length collection of poetry, “Mosaic of the Dark,” is available from Black Lawrence Press.
Dan Brady
Latest Title: Strange Children
Dan Brady is the author of the poetry collection “Strange Children” (Publishing Genius, 2018) and two chapbooks, “Cabin Fever / Fossil Record” (Flying Guillotine Press) and “Leroy Sequences” (Horse Less Press). He is the poetry editor of Barrelhouse and lives in Arlington, Va., with his wife and two kids. Previously, Dan served as the editor of “American Poets,” the journal of the Academy of American Poets, and worked in the Literature Division at the National Endowment for the Arts, where he received a Distinguished Service Award for work on the Big Read, the largest community reading initiative in U.S. history.
